A Churchill Show comedian Young Juma who brought laughter to many homes with his performance has died.

The kid comedian died on Tuesday morning after battling an undisclosed illness.

"After a long ailment, Juma passed on yesterday morning at his mum's place in kiamaiko. We lost a very vibrant young soul and also breadwinner, we know God is always there to protect and guide your left family. We will pray for your soul and spirit. REST IN PEACE JUMA???? You will always be remembered," Nairobi Matatu Sacco head Jimal Marlow shared.

Juma was discovered at a young age back in 2015 and made several appearances on the Churchill Show where he also opened up on the struggles of growing up in Kiamaiko slums.

Kenyans first met Juma when e was featured on Churchill Show’s Totos Corner while studying at Valley Bridge primary school exuded. He became an instant crowd favourite.

Churchill hosted him on the show with his mother. Churchill had looked for some sponsors who pledged to pay Juma’s school fees.
